.mybento-section{background:#fff;padding:80px 0;position:relative;overflow:hidden}.mybento-section:before{content:"";position:absolute;top:0;left:0;right:0;bottom:0;background:radial-gradient(circle at 20% 50%,rgba(239,68,68,.02) 0%,transparent 50%),radial-gradient(circle at 80% 20%,rgba(239,68,68,.02) 0%,transparent 50%);pointer-events:none}.container{max-width:1200px;margin:0 auto;padding:0 24px;position:relative;z-index:1}.header-content{text-align:center;margin-bottom:64px;animation:fadeInUp .8s ease-out}.main-title{font-size:3rem;font-weight:700;color:#1f2937;margin:0 0 16px;line-height:1.1;letter-spacing:-.025em}.subtitle{font-size:1.125rem;color:#64748b;max-width:600px;margin:0 auto;line-height:1.6;font-weight:400}.features-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(280px,1fr));gap:32px;margin-top:48px}.feature-card{background:#fffc;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);border-radius:20px;padding:40px 32px;text-align:center;transition:all .4s cubic-bezier(.4,0,.2,1);border:1px solid rgba(255,255,255,.2);position:relative;overflow:hidden;animation:fadeInUp .8s ease-out;animation-fill-mode:both}.feature-card:nth-child(1){animation-delay:.1s}.feature-card:nth-child(2){animation-delay:.2s}.feature-card:nth-child(3){animation-delay:.3s}.feature-card:nth-child(4){animation-delay:.4s}.feature-card:before{content:"";position:absolute;top:0;left:-100%;width:100%;height:100%;background:linear-gradient(90deg,transparent,rgba(255,255,255,.3),transparent);transition:left .6s ease-in-out}.feature-card:hover{transform:translateY(-8px);box-shadow:0 20px 40px #0000001a;background:#fffffff2}.feature-card:hover:before{left:100%}.icon-container{width:80px;height:80px;background:linear-gradient(135deg,#ef4444,#dc2626);border-radius:50%;display:flex;align-items:center;justify-content:center;margin:0 auto 24px;transition:all .4s cubic-bezier(.4,0,.2,1);position:relative;overflow:hidden}.icon-container:before{content:"";position:absolute;top:0;left:0;right:0;bottom:0;background:linear-gradient(45deg,rgba(255,255,255,.2) 0%,transparent 100%);border-radius:50%}.feature-card:hover .icon-container{transform:scale(1.1) rotate(5deg);box-shadow:0 10px 30px #ef44444d}.icon-container.highlight{background:linear-gradient(135deg,#dc2626,#b91c1c);box-shadow:0 8px 25px #dc262640}.icon{width:32px;height:32px;color:#fff;stroke-width:2.5}.feature-title{font-size:1.25rem;font-weight:600;color:#1f2937;margin:0 0 12px;line-height:1.3;transition:color .3s ease}.feature-title.highlight,.feature-card:hover .feature-title{color:#dc2626}.feature-description{font-size:1rem;color:#b83030;line-height:1.6;margin:0;transition:color .3s ease}.feature-card:hover .feature-description{color:#694747}@keyframes fadeInUp{0%{opacity:0;transform:translateY(30px)}to{opacity:1;transform:translateY(0)}}@media (max-width: 768px){.mybento-section{padding:60px 0}.container{padding:0 16px}.main-title{font-size:2.25rem;margin-bottom:12px}.subtitle{font-size:1rem}.header-content{margin-bottom:48px}.features-grid{grid-template-columns:1fr;gap:24px;margin-top:32px}.feature-card{padding:32px 24px}.icon-container{width:32pxpx;height:32px;margin-bottom:20px}.icon{width:32px;height:32px}.feature-title{font-size:1.125rem}.feature-description{font-size:.9rem}}@media (max-width: 480px){.main-title{font-size:1.875rem}.features-grid{gap:20px}.feature-card{padding:28px 20px;border-radius:16px}}@media (-webkit-min-device-pixel-ratio: 2),(min-resolution: 192dpi){.feature-card{border:1px solid rgba(255,255,255,.3)}}@media (prefers-color-scheme: dark){.mybento-section{background:linear-gradient(135deg,#0f172a,#1e293b)}.main-title{color:#f1f5f9}.subtitle{color:#94a3b8}.feature-card{background:#1e293bcc;border-color:#3341554d}.feature-title{color:#f1f5f9}.feature-description{color:#94a3b8}.feature-card:hover{background:#1e293bf2}.feature-card:hover .feature-description{color:#cbd5e1}}@media print{.mybento-section{background:#fff;padding:40px 0}.feature-card{background:#fff;border:1px solid #e2e8f0;break-inside:avoid}.icon-container{background:#dc2626}}
/*# sourceMappingURL=/cdn/shop/t/62/assets/features.css.map */
